Population Overview

Golinda city is a small community located in Texas. The total population is 771. It ranks as the 1119th most populous out of 1,800 cities and towns in Texas.

Age Demographics

The median age in Golinda city is 45.6 years. This is 28% higher than the state median of 35.5 years.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Golinda city is $47,500. This is 38% lower than the state median of $76,292.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 40% lower. The poverty rate stands at 22.4%. This is 63% higher than the state poverty rate of 13.8%. With more than one in five residents living below the poverty line, economic hardship is a significant challenge for the community. The unemployment rate is 2.6%. This is 49% lower than the state rate of 5.1%. The median home value is $145,800. Housing costs are 44% lower than the state median of $260,400. The home-value-to-income ratio is 3.1x. 92.6%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 48% higher than the state average of 62.6%.

Race & Ethnicity

The largest racial or ethnic group in Golinda city is White (non-Hispanic), making up 59.9% of the population.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 22.7%. The White (non-Hispanic) population is significantly higher than the state average (59.9% vs 39.9%). The Asian population (1.9%) is well below the state average of 5.3%.

Education

23.3%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 30% lower than the state rate of 33.1%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 93.8%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Golinda city, Texas is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Texas state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 1,800 Census-designated places in Texas.
